Union Beach is a small borough located in Monmouth County, New Jersey. This coastal town, which is often referred to as the “Heart of the Bayshore,” offers a tight-knit community atmosphere and a rich history that reflects its strong commitment to resilience.
With a population of just over 5,000 residents, Union Beach boasts a strong sense of community. Neighbors know each other by name, and gatherings and events are common throughout the year. The town takes pride in its strong community spirit, which is evident in its numerous organizations, clubs, and volunteer opportunities. The Union Beach Memorial School, which serves students from pre-kindergarten through eighth grade, also plays an active role in fostering a sense of community and pride among its students and their families.
Unfortunately, Union Beach is known for experiencing extreme devastation during Hurricane Sandy in 2012. The storm caused severe damage to the town, displacing many residents and destroying homes and businesses. Despite this tragedy, the community has come together to rebuild and recover. Through the efforts of volunteers, government assistance, and organizations such as Rebuild Union Beach, the town has made remarkable progress in restoring its infrastructure and revitalizing the local economy. Today, Union Beach stands as a symbol of resilience and determination.
In addition to its strong community bonds, Union Beach offers residents and visitors access to beautiful natural landscapes. The borough is situated along the Raritan Bay, providing stunning views and opportunities for activities such as fishing, boating, and hiking. The town is also home to several parks and recreational facilities, where residents can enjoy sports, picnics, and outdoor gatherings.
